  4. Reply from Ashdown....

    "The amp will give you it's full power when loaded into 4 Ohms... The two sockets are joined together internally,
    so you can for instance connect TWO 8 Ohm cabs to give you the minimum 4 Ohms impedance for full power"..



    So there we go, question answered! :)

  7. Spector Euro 4LX.

    A bit battle scarred, but nothing too onerous.....

    Original owner decided to move the strap nipple to centre line of body, (shown in pic). I am currently filling and lacquering this as we speak

    A couple of little dings on the back, and a few little scuff marks around the outer edge.(these should polish out with a good renovator polish). (again shown in pics).

    Slim neck, not to dissimilar from a Jazz, any try out welcome, I live in the Staffordshire area, if anyone is close enough.

    Great tone, great action..great workhorse, (does exactly what it says on the tin!!).

    Comes with Hiscox hardcase.

    Spector bumph....

    Original Spector NS curved body style
    • Graphite Reinforced 3pc Neck-Thru Body, USA Rock Maple Neck
    • Body Wings: Alder
    • Top Wood,USA Figured maple
    • 24 Fret Rosewood Fingerboard, mother of pearl Spector inlays
    • 34" Scale Length
    • Gold Plated Hardware: Spector Brass Zinc Alloy Locking Bridge, Schaller Tuners and Straplocks
    • Classic: EMG P/J active pickups.
    • Spector TonePump™ boost only active bass and treble tone controls
    • Width at nut 1.64", String Spacing at bridge .75", Fingerboard radius 16"
    • Finishes: Maple Top: High Gloss: Black Cherry
